It's possible there is some problem internally in kde-plasma-networkmanagement, but it's difficult to fix it and because upstream is basically dead and there is a new NM applet, you can try whether the bug is in the new one (kde-plasma-nm). Anyway, traffic monitor in NM applet is not much accurate (but it's usually enough for regular users) and it takes a while when it's loaded. It's not possible to make it better, because it takes data from "systemmonitor" Plasma dataengine. If you want proper monitoring, you will have to use probably KNemo. kde-plasma-nm has the same problem. KNemo shows my traffic. Hmm, that's weird.
